The Biking Solution

Bicycling is a $5-billion business in the United States. And as more and more people make the leap from health consciousness to healthy action, the number of cycling devotees grows.

Industry dynamics make it difficult for independent bike retailers to be profitable. The good news is that The Bike Cooperative® (TBC) levels the playing field for progressive retailers by leveraging economies of scale with a broad range of service providers.

With TBC behind them, specialty retailers have access to the most innovative cost-saving, marketing and training programs in the industry — everything they need to run their businesses smarter and easier.

As a result, The Bike Cooperative’s nearly 300 independent member stores enhance productivity, seize opportunities, improve profitability and reach their goals.

Special treatment for specialty stores
TBC member retailers enjoy industry-best savings on a broad array of operational needs and services engineered through the combined buying power of all CCA Global retailers. Members reap the considerable benefits of TBC partnerships to offer their customers products and services at a level that their competitors cannot. TBC members receive extra rebate dollars on products purchased through more than 20 preferred suppliers.

TBC offers a broad range of marketing programs to help retailers build their own unique brands in a crowded marketplace, including options for direct mail, email, and social media. Members even have the option to map out an entire year of advertising in one session, maximizing both their planning time and promotional budgets. Members use TBC’s Ride Club customer loyalty program to send out customer communications and rewards uniquely configured for their individual stores.

TBC is also helping retailers increase their margins and profit through the development of private label parts, accessories, and bikes under the COBO brand. By working directly with partner suppliers, the co-op can deliver high-quality cycling products to member retailers at a lower cost.

Powerful training programs deliver practical and profitable results, enabling members to raise sales revenue through better-trained sales staff. Managers and owners profit from direct access to TBC’s storemanagement experts.
